The Creator regarding the Very Very First Online Dating Service Is Still Dating On Line

Before he started the site that is first online dating sites, Andrew Conru had started one of the primary businesses that made internet sites when it comes to newfangled Around The Globe online right right back. The endeavor ended up being called Web Media Services, needless to say.

“we had individuals calling me up and asking ‘Are you the net?'” the engineer that is 48-year-old me personally. “and then we said ‘Yeah,’ and attempted to offer them a few of our solutions. We had been the only business in the telephone book aided by the word ‘internet’ in it.”

The world-wide-web changed a whole lot within the last 25 years, and Conru possessed a front line chair. In just what he calls “being within the place that is right the proper time,” he began online Personals in 1993 while doing their doctorate at Stanford University, seated in identical class as “the inventors from bing.”

Conru very very very first helped work with the internet site for their tiny division at Stanford’s Center for Design research, which inspired him to launch Web Media Services with approximately ten to fifteen employees—all at the same time whenever few individuals knew exactly just what the net had been.

Per year later on, Conru began online Personals, perhaps the initial online dating service ever, that has been run by a team of Stanford grad students plus one bright-eyed school kid that is high. The concept hit Conru in their dorm space as a real method to kickstart their love life following a breakup—as he quickly recognized, he had been stuck within an engineering system packed with guys. “the chances had been bad and I also had to look somewhere else,” stated Conru.

He tried paper personals, which calls for making abbreviations to match two-inch containers, and video dating where one could watch VHS videos of individuals’s profiles and contact them. It absolutely was “a really process that is manual” Conru recalled.

But Web Personals showcased large pictures and a entire web page of text per profile. “That is what you see on most of the sites that are dating, except Tinder,” said Conru. “They went the whole other method with just one photo.”

Internet Personals took two months to construct, ended up being printed in C++, and had the capacity to monitor users from web web page to page. It was before snacks had been typical on browsers, plus it had been difficult to keep an eye on individuals page that is visiting page. (Nowadays we all simply just just take powerful webpages for provided, however they desired to monitor internet site visitors pressing from web page to page for internet shopping possibilities, as Conru additionally invented the web shopping cart application.)

Conru created ways to ID pass a user from page to page and then look within the user information from the database and personalize website pages dynamically (image below from their individual manual).

“Although we go on it for awarded today that internet sites change dynamically predicated on whom you had been, into the very early times, web sites had been simply static pages, everyone else saw the same,” stated Conru.

“we were holding the times whenever internet sites had been constantly fixed, everybody saw exactly exactly the same page that is exact” stated Conru. “to help make the web web page powerful, predicated on who you really are, ended up being variety of a unique thing.”

When you look at the 1 . 5 years Conru ran your website, he said there have been 120,000 sign ups. “I would state approximately half of these had ‘.edu’ e-mails,” he said, which recommended that pupils or college employees were utilizing it. “It had been the biggest internet dating internet site until it had been surpassed by Match.”

After running Web Personals for around a he “didn’t know any better” and sold it to telepersonalsfor $100,000 year. Soon after he got out from the non-compete, he began another dating internet site, FriendFinder.

Because of the time he completed their doctorate, Conru had been FriendFinder that is running with workers. “we always joked i will have fallen away and be a billionaire,” stated Conru.
